Overview
Hillsborough County holds contractors accountable through its Code Compliance Bond — a financial guarantee that work performed under county permits meets local building codes and standards. If a contractor walks off a job, cuts corners, or violates code requirements, this bond gives the county a mechanism to recover the cost of bringing that work into compliance. It protects the public, property owners, and the integrity of Hillsborough County's construction standards. Who Needs This Bond?
Contractors pulling permits and performing construction work in Hillsborough County, Florida need this bond. That includes general contractors, specialty trades, and any contractor required to register locally with Hillsborough County before performing permitted work. If Hillsborough County's Building Services or a related local authority has told you to produce a Code Compliance Bond, this is the one. It is a county-level requirement tied to local registration — it does not substitute for any state license you may separately hold.
What is this Bond For?
This bond guarantees that a contractor will follow Hillsborough County's applicable building codes, ordinances, and permit conditions on every job site where they are authorized to work. When a contractor fails to meet those standards — abandons work, leaves code violations unresolved, or causes damage through noncompliant construction — the bond provides a financial remedy for the county or affected parties. It is not a performance bond for a single project; it is a standing compliance guarantee tied to a contractor's local registration. The bond keeps bad actors off Hillsborough County job sites by making code violations financially consequential.
When is it Required?
Registration with Hillsborough County as a licensed contractor is the moment this bond becomes mandatory. Before the county issues a local registration or allows you to pull building permits under that registration, the Code Compliance Bond must be in place. If you are expanding your business into Hillsborough County from another Florida county or municipality, you will need to satisfy this requirement as part of the local registration process — regardless of what bonds you already carry elsewhere. Do not wait until your first permit application to address this; the bond must be active at registration.
Where Does it Apply?
This bond applies exclusively to contractor work performed within Hillsborough County, Florida — including unincorporated areas under county jurisdiction. It is a local county requirement administered by Hillsborough County, not by the Florida Department of Business and Professional Regulation or any state licensing board. Contractors working across multiple Florida jurisdictions will need to verify bond requirements in each separate county or municipality where they operate.

Frequently Asked Questions
Does the Hillsborough County Code Compliance Bond satisfy my Florida state contractor license bond requirement?
No. These are two separate obligations. The Hillsborough County Code Compliance Bond satisfies a county-level registration requirement — it is issued with Hillsborough County as the obligee. If your Florida state license through the DBPR or the Florida Construction Industry Licensing Board requires a separate bond, that is a distinct instrument you will need to obtain independently. Holding this county bond does not replace or fulfill any state-level surety requirement.
Does the bond need to be active before I bid on work in Hillsborough County, or only before I break ground?
The bond needs to be in place before Hillsborough County will process your local contractor registration — and that registration is what allows you to pull permits and bid on permitted work in the county. As a practical matter, you should have this bond secured before you do anything that requires an active local registration number. Waiting until you have a signed contract or a start date puts your schedule at risk.
I already have a Code Compliance Bond in another Florida county. Do I need a new one for Hillsborough County?
Yes. A bond issued for a different county or municipality names that jurisdiction as the obligee and is not transferable to Hillsborough County. When you expand into Hillsborough County or relocate your operations here, you need a separate bond that specifically names Hillsborough County and satisfies its registration requirements. Each jurisdiction's bond stands on its own.
